偷偷摘套内射激情视频,久久精品99国产国产精,中文字幕无线乱码人妻,中文在线中文a,性爽19p

Windows Phone 7 UI設(shè)計理念

原創(chuàng)
移動開發(fā)
在這篇文章中,51CTO將展示如何使用新的開發(fā)工具,SDK和移動設(shè)備模擬器從零開始為Windows Phone 7構(gòu)建一個Silverlight UI,假設(shè)你已經(jīng)熟悉Silverlight和Visual Studio 2010的基礎(chǔ)知識。

【51CTO譯文】Silverlight for Windows Phone是Windows Phone 7的應(yīng)用程序開發(fā)平臺,Windows Phone 7支持Silverlight的核心功能,通過托管的.NET代碼提供訪問Windows Phone 7獨一無二的功能。

熟悉XAML和托管.NET代碼的開發(fā)人員可以使用新的開發(fā)工具創(chuàng)建Windows Phone 7系列應(yīng)用程序,在這篇文章中,51CTO將展示如何使用新的開發(fā)工具,SDK和移動設(shè)備模擬器從零開始為Windows Phone 7構(gòu)建一個Silverlight UI,假設(shè)你已經(jīng)熟悉Silverlight和Visual Studio 2010的基礎(chǔ)知識。

首先,你必須下載并安裝Silverlight for Windows Phone開發(fā)工具,在Silverlight for Windows Phone主頁能找到最新版本的下載鏈接。

安裝完畢后,在開始菜單就會多出一項“Microsoft Visual Studio 2010 Express”,如果你安裝了其它Visual Studio版本,就不用啟動“Visual Studio 2010 Express”文件夾下的“Microsoft Visual Studio 2010 Express for Windows Phone”,你可以直接在以前安裝的Visual Studio中開發(fā)Windows Phone Silverlight應(yīng)用程序。

啟動Visual Studio 2010,選擇“文件”*“新建”*“項目”,在Visual C#已安裝模板列表中選擇“Silverlight for Windows Phone”,圖1顯示了你可以為Windows Phone創(chuàng)建Silverlight應(yīng)用程序的三種類型。

◆Windows Phone Application:沒有導航支持的應(yīng)用程序。

◆Windows Phone List Application:有導航支持的應(yīng)用程序。

◆Windows Phone Class Library:一個類庫,你可以在其它應(yīng)用程序中使用。

Silverlight for Windows Phone新建項目時提供的模板 
圖 1 Silverlight for Windows Phone新建項目時提供的模板

如果你在Visual C#已安裝模板列表中選擇“XNA Game Studio 4.0”,你會發(fā)現(xiàn)也有與Windows Phone相關(guān)的新項目類型,實際上,Silverlight for Windows Phone可以使用XNA Framework實現(xiàn)音頻的采集和回訪,訪問媒體庫和Xbox LIVE。

Silverlight for Windows Phone 7允許你充分利用已有的Silverlight經(jīng)驗編寫Windows Phone應(yīng)用程序,Visual Studio 2010簡化了UI設(shè)計和調(diào)試Windows Phone 7應(yīng)用程序的復雜性,在模擬器的幫助下,你可以方便地進行調(diào)試和測試。

當你需要創(chuàng)建復雜的UI時,Expression Blend 4 for Windows Phone可以幫助你減少開發(fā)時間,如果你想加快學習步伐,建議結(jié)合Expression Blend 4和Visual Studio 2010使用,要和手機交互還有很多新的命名空間和類需要學習,但用到的還是XAML和C#知識。Silverlight for Windows Phone 7提供了一個為創(chuàng)建和云交互的富移動應(yīng)用程序提供了極大的方便。

原文出處:http://www.drdobbs.com/windows/227701092;jsessionid=0LPPSGFA3UDNBQE1GHPSKH4ATMY32JVN

原文名:Developing a Silverlight UI for Windows Phone 7

作者:Gaston Hillar

【51CTO譯稿,非經(jīng)授權(quán)謝絕轉(zhuǎn)載,合作媒體轉(zhuǎn)載請注明原文出處、作者及51CTO譯稿和譯者!】

【編輯推薦】 

  1. 簡述Windows Phone 7應(yīng)用程序開發(fā)平臺
  2. Windows Phone 7 UI設(shè)計菜單:代碼隱藏文件和啟動畫面
  3.  Windows Phone 7 UI設(shè)計菜單:理解MainPage.xaml
  4. Windows Phone 7開發(fā)工具發(fā)布更新包 附下載地址
  5. 微軟推Windows Phone 7 Silverlight程序員成贏家

 

責任編輯:佚名 來源: 51CTO獨家譯稿
相關(guān)推薦

2010-03-09 10:51:15

Windows Pho

2010-11-10 10:12:21

MainPage.xaUI設(shè)計Windows Pho

2010-11-24 16:15:09

UI設(shè)計Windows Pho

2010-11-24 16:36:02

Windows PhoUI設(shè)計Windows Pho

2012-03-20 21:05:53

Windows Pho

2011-12-29 21:22:29

Windows Pho

2010-10-25 14:07:55

Windows Pho

2011-03-28 09:08:04

評測報告設(shè)計Windows Pho

2010-11-04 18:11:35

UI設(shè)計SilverlightWindows Pho

2013-04-12 11:02:50

WWindowsPho

2010-08-02 14:47:51

Windows PhoWindows PhoWindows Pho

2010-11-26 16:00:08

Windows Pho

2013-07-30 11:18:37

Windows PhoWindows Pho

2010-05-05 13:16:02

Windows PhoWindows CE

2011-08-22 16:45:58

Windows PhoiOS

2012-05-29 21:38:14

Metro UI

2011-06-08 09:43:15

Windows Pho

2011-06-07 11:35:38

Windows Pho

2010-07-21 14:56:21

Windows Pho

2010-12-01 13:40:13

樞軸控件Windows Pho
點贊
收藏

51CTO技術(shù)棧公眾號